The Hakone Circuit Trail is a popular choice among hikers, offering a diverse range of scenery. This 10-kilometer loop takes you around the stunning Lake Ashi, with views of Mount Fuji on clear days. The trail is relatively easy and suitable for all skill levels. Along the way, you can explore various points of interest, including the Hakone Shrine and the historic Hakone Checkpoint.

For those seeking a more challenging hike, the Mount Hakone Summit Trail is a fantastic option. This trail ascends to the peak of Mount Hakone, providing panoramic views of the surrounding volcanic landscape. The trek is about 6 kilometers one way, and hikers should be prepared for steep sections. At the summit, you will be rewarded with breathtaking vistas, especially during sunrise or sunset.
The Owakudani Trail is famous for its volcanic activity and sulfuric hot springs. This 3-kilometer trail offers unique geological features and stunning views of the Hakone mountains. As you hike, you can take in the steam rising from the volcanic vents and even sample the famous black eggs boiled in the hot springs. The trail is also accessible via the Hakone Ropeway, making it easy for visitors to reach the starting point.
The Sengokuhara Nature Trail is a serene walk through beautiful grasslands and cedar forests. This easy 4-kilometer trail is perfect for families and casual walkers. Along the way, you can spot various wildflowers and enjoy the tranquil beauty of the area. The trail also offers stunning views of the surrounding mountains, making it an ideal spot for photography.
